    Trabalho final de Mestrado para a obtenção de grau de Mestre em Engenharia da Qualidade e Ambiente As empresas e organizações cada vez mais se encontram expostas a riscos que podem ter impacto na sua sobrevivência a curto, médio e longo-prazo. Assim, é necessário que sejam capazes de efetuar uma abordagem holística ao risco e à sustentabilidade da sua cadeia de negócios. Cada vez mais as empresas e organizações procuram preparar-se para os riscos a que estão expostas, tentando mitigar, responder e recuperar a eventos inesperados com consequências a níveis económicos, sociais, ambientais, geopolíticos e tecnológicos, tentando ser mais resilientes. A norma ISO 22301 tem um papel bastante importante, para que as empresas e organizações possam planear a continuidade dos seus negócios, no que diz respeito à ocorrência de eventos disruptivos e inesperados nas suas cadeias de negócios. Durante a fase da pandemia da COVID-19 e agora mais recentemente com o conflito entre a Rússia e Ucrânia as empresas depararam-se com eventos que podem colocar em causa a sua continuidade nos seus negócios. Desta forma, foi realizado estudo que pretende fazer o levantamento, ao nível dos riscos a que as empresas e organizações estão expostas, nomeadamente a empresas do ramo automóvel, sendo um dos ramos mais afetados durante e pós-pandemia. Companies and organizations are increasingly exposed to risks that can impact their survival in the short, medium and long term. Therefore, they need to be able to take a holistic approach to the risk and sustainability of their business chain. More and more companies and organizations seek to prepare for the risks to which they are exposed, trying to mitigate, respond and recover from unexpected events with consequences at economic, social, environmental, geopolitical and technological levels, trying to be more resilient. The standard ISO 22301 has a very important role, for companies and organizations to plan the continuity of their business, regarding the occurrence of disruptive and unexpected events in their business chains. During the phase of the COVID-19 pandemic and now more recently with the conflict between Russia and Ukraine, companies faced events that could endanger their continuity in their business. In this way, a study was carried out that aims to survey, at the level of the risks to which companies and organizations are exposed, namely to companies in the automotive industry, being one of the most affected branches during and post-pandemic N/A

    Dissertação de Mestrado Integrado em Arquitetura apresentada à Faculdade de Ciências e Tecnologia A dissertação de mestrado aqui apresentada foi desenvolvida a partir do tema B da cadeira de Seminário de Investigação do ano letivo 2020/2021 com o título “Cabo do Mundo 21: Projeto para uma Cidade Urgente, pensar na arquitetura da cidade post. COVID + post. OIL”. Este tema surgiu da necessidade de repensar a forma como as cidades são vividas e utilizadas e, seguidamente, materializar essa investigação num lugar muito marcado pelo aproveitamento das energias fósseis: a Refinaria de Leça da Palmeira.O tema propõe a reabilitação do espaço ocupado por esta refinaria, imaginando a sua extinção até ao ano de 2050 (ano-objetivo para a “neutralidade carbónica” em Portugal), atribuindo-lhe novas funções com o intuito de proporcionar uma nova vida e imagem a este local tão marcado pela forte industrialização da segunda metade do século XX.A partir desta temática foi necessário realizar várias análises a diferentes níveis tanto da zona ocupada pela refinaria, como também da freguesia de Leça da Palmeira e do concelho de Matosinhos para melhor compreender como abordar este território.Este exercício prático foi produzido em três fases: de turma, de grupo e individual. Na primeira foi desenvolvida uma estratégia geral de intervenção e foram definidos os pontos mais importantes a seguir por todos os alunos, para criar uma coesão geral no projeto. Já na segunda, foi feita uma aproximação a uma parte deste território, onde se deu continuidade a malhas industriais existentes adicionando novos volumes e espaços verdes para as consolidar. Foi então na terceira fase que se desenvolveu o projeto individual sobre a apropriação de dois quarteirões existentes na malha industrial para a sua reestruturação e criação de um centro criativo.Sendo assim, este trabalho de reabilitação tem sempre associado os temas da descarbonização do planeta, da adaptação a situações mais extremas de saúde global (como é o caso da pandemia do COVID-19) e da transformação da vida urbana num quadro mais sustentável tanto a nível ecológico como também económico, tal como esperado dentro de poucas décadas. The master thesis presented in this document was developed based on the theme B proposed in the lecture Research Seminar of the academic year 2020/2021 entitled “Cabo do Mundo 21: Project for an Urgent City, thinking about the architecture of the post. COVID + post. OIL city”. This theme surfaced from the need to rethink the way cities are lived and utilized and, after that, to materialize that research in a place that is very iconic of the times that are being lived right now, dominated by fossil fuels: the Refinery of Leça da Palmeira.The theme proposes the rehabilitation of the area occupied by this refinery, considering its extinction until 2050 (year-objective for the “carbon neutrality” in Portugal), creating new functions with the goal of giving a new life and appearance to this place that is so characterized by the uncontrolled industrialization of the 20th century. Based on this idea and to better understand how to approach this region, it was necessary to develop several analyses at different levels of the area of the refinery, Leça da Palmeira and the municipality of Matosinhos.This project was produced in three steps: class, group and individual. In the first step it was developed a general intervention strategy and were defined the most important aspects to follow by all the students to create a general cohesion in the project as a whole. In the second one the work was focused on a section of the terrain, where the existent industrial grids were redesigned while creating new volumes and green spaces. In the third and last step it was developed the individual project about the adaptation of two existent industrial blocks and its restructuring to house a new creative center.Finally, this rehabilitation project is always associated with the need of decarbonizing the world, the adaptation to more extreme global health issues (like the COVID-19 pandemic) and the transformation of the urban lifestyle into one more sustainable, both ecologically and economically, as it should be in a few decades.

    As preocupações com a segurança energética e alimentar estão patentes em diversas políticas europeias e internacionais, que reforçam a importância de acelerar e financiar a transição energética através da implementação de tecnologias de baixo carbono, com os objetivos de neutralidade carbónica e de reduzir os efeitos das alterações climáticas na agricultura. No entanto, para a concretização destes objetivos, torna-se necessário entender a aceitação social da descarbonização do setor agroalimentar e dimensões sociopsicológicas associadas. Neste sentido, esta investigação contribui para uma primeira exploração das representações da imprensa escrita em Portugal sobre a descarbonização deste setor, considerando que os media são um dos principais atores nas sociedades contemporâneas responsáveis pela co-construção e transformação de representações sociais e mudanças sociais relacionadas. Através de uma análise temática, este trabalho examina artigos (N=102) de cinco jornais portugueses (Público, Jornal de Negócios, Observador, Jornal Económico e Correio da Manhã), selecionados entre o período de 1 de fevereiro de 2021 e 30 de junho de 2022. As análises revelam a pouca discussão e disseminação das questões de descarbonização do setor agroalimentar na imprensa nacional. O discurso sobre as questões de descarbonização é essencialmente abafado pelas crises da atualidade (i.e., pandemia covid-19, seca extrema e a invasão da Ucrânia pela Rússia) e a relação entre energia e o setor agroalimentar é maioritariamente apresentada com foco na dimensão económica (vs. Ambiental e social), nos grandes produtores e a nível nacional (vs. Regional e local). The concern regarding energy and food security is evident in several European and international policies, which reinforces the importance of accelerating and financing the energy transition through the implementation of low-carbon technologies, with the goals of carbon neutrality and reducing the effects of climate change in agriculture. However, to achieve these goals, it is necessary to understand the social acceptance of the decarbonisation of the agri-food sector and associated socio-psychological dimensions. In a sense, this research contributes to a first exploration of the representations of the written press in Portugal around the decarbonisation in the sector; considering that the media are one of the main players in contemporary societies responsible for the co-construction and transformation of social representations and related social changes. Through a thematic analysis, this work examines articles (N=102) from five Portuguese newspapers (Público, Jornal de Negócios, Observador, Jornal Económico and Correio da Manhã), selected between the period of February 1, 2021, and June 30 from 2022. The analysis reveals little discussion and dissemination of decarbonisation issues in the agri-food sector in the national press. The discourse on decarbonisation issues is essentially drowned out by current crises (i.e., the covid-19 pandemic, extreme drought, and the invasion of Ukraine by Russia). The relationship between energy and the agri-food sector is mostly presented with a focus on the economic dimension (vs. Environmental and social), in large producers and national level (vs. Regional and local).

    A concentração das populações nas cidades se mostra uma tendência mundial com repercussões não só na escala local como também global. A expansão urbana com origem nesta realidade, se feita sem planejamento e gestão, gera uma série de externalidades que afetam a qualidade de vidas de seus habitantes não só no presente, como também para o futuro das próximas gerações. Cidades sustentáveis terão melhores chances de enfrentar os desafios advindos do seu próprio crescimento e proporcionar mais felicidade aos seus moradores do amanhã. A mobilidade urbana também deve ser sustentável para que este intento seja alcançado conciliando necessidades e interesses nas perspectivas do meio ambiente, da justiça social e prosperidade econômica. Ganha destaque a avaliação sistemática das estratégias adotadas para corrigir desvios de trajetória à sustentabilidade. Neste ponto, o uso de indicadores e índices possuem comprovada capacidade de avaliar políticas públicas e apoiar a tomada de decisão nos níveis estratégico e tático da administração das urbes, além de gerar conhecimento útil à melhoria contínua. Assim, este trabalho de pesquisa traz uma metodologia para obter um índice de mobilidade urbana sustentável que seja prático, para favorecer sua incorporação por vários municípios; universal, para assegurar a sua aplicabilidade em cidades de diversos contextos; abrangente, para mensurar os diversos aspectos da sustentabilidade aplicada aos transportes urbanos e seus serviços; e objetivo, para comunicar com diversos públicos. Desta forma, o alvo maior foi o de avaliar a mobilidade urbana de Brasília, na perspectiva macro estabelecendo o grau de sustentabilidade do seu sistema em nível estratégico, por meio da consolidação de um conjunto bem sedimentado de indicadores no Índice de Mobilidade Urbana Sustentável para Brasília (IMUSB). A opção pela Capital brasileira deveu-se ao fato de ser a cidade onde o Autor atua na área da mobilidade urbana e em consequência das restrições à continuidade da investigação em Lisboa/Pt por ocasião da pandemia da COVID-19. A aplicação do IMUSB em Brasília revelou forças e fraquezas de seu sistema de mobilidade urbana, coerente com a realidade observada. Além de repercutir a vocação rodoviarista de Brasília, o IMUSB confirmou que a produção de dados e divulgação de informações é o principal obstáculo a ser superado para a avaliação da mobilidade urbana sustentável. A ferramenta de avaliação está pronta, mas os gestores públicos devem liderar o processo de produção, integração e disponibilização de informações para que o Índice de Mobilidade Urbana Sustentável para Brasília sirva com orientador da busca de cidades melhores e mais sustentáveis. The concentration of populations in cities is a global trend with repercussions not only on a local scale but also on a global scale. Urban expansion arising from this reality, if carried out without planning and management, generates a series of externalities that affect the quality of life of its inhabitants not only in the present, but also for the future of the next generations. Sustainable cities will have better chances to face the challenges arising from their own growth and provide more happiness to their residents of tomorrow. Urban mobility must also be sustainable so that this intent is achieved by reconciling needs and interests in the perspectives of the environment, social justice, and economic prosperity. The systematic evaluation of the strategies adopted to correct deviations from the trajectory towards sustainability is highlighted. At this point, the use of indicators and indices have proven ability to assess public policies and support decision-making at the strategic and tactical levels of urban administration, in addition to generating useful knowledge for continuous improvement. Thus, this research work brings a methodology to obtain a practical sustainable urban mobility index, to support its incorporation by several municipalities; universal, to ensure its applicability in cities of different contexts; comprehensive, to measure the various aspects of sustainability applied to urban transport and its services; and objective, to communicate with different audiences. Thus, the main objective was to assess Brasília's urban mobility, from a macro perspective, establishing the degree of sustainability of its system at a strategic level, through the consolidation of a well-established set of indicators in the Sustainable Urban Mobility Index for Brasília (IMUSB). The option for the Brazilian capital was because it is the city where the author works around urban mobility and because of restrictions to the continuity of the investigation in Lisbon/PT due to the COVID-19 pandemic. The application of the IMUSB in Brasília revealed strengths and weaknesses of its urban mobility system, consistent with the observed reality. In addition to reflecting Brasília's vocation for road transport, the IMUSB confirmed that the production of data and dissemination of information is the main obstacle to be overcome for the assessment of sustainable urban mobility. The assessment tool is ready, but public managers must lead the process of production, integration, and availability of information so that the Sustainable Urban Mobility Index for Brasília can serve as a guide in the search for better and more sustainable cities.

    A presente dissertação tem o intuito de compreender qual o perfil atual dos clientes de eventos e reuniões corporate no Concelho de Cascais, na perspetiva dos organizadores, de forma a averiguar qual o padrão de procura e atitude dos clientes face a três tendências atuais. O estudo iniciou-se com a pesquisa das características dos clientes corporativos durante o processo de compra e planeamento, assim como os seus cargos e funções. Além deste aspeto, desenvolveu-se o estudo do seu perfil relativamente à sua atitude face a três tendências globais atuais: a sustentabilidade, os eventos híbridos e online, e a diversidade e inclusão. Por último, focou-se na análise da evolução e mudança do perfil no contexto temporal pré e pós 2020 (pandemia Covid-19). Para o efeito, para além da pesquisa efetuada através da revisão de literatura, foram realizadas entrevistas a organizadores de eventos corporativos de diversas unidades hoteleiras e espaços de eventos no Concelho de Cascais, assim como a organizadores que trabalham em empresas de eventos responsáveis por eventos corporativos que ocorrem em diversos locais no Concelho de Cascais. Através da análise de resultados verifica-se que atualmente o perfil do cliente corporativo no Concelho de Cascais define-se por um conjunto de características diversificadas, com um aumento de interesse por práticas de sustentabilidade, diversidade e inclusão, no entanto ainda com uma expressão bastante reduzida, e com uma valorização atual pelos eventos híbridos, como complemento aos eventos presenciais. Destaca-se também o impacto que a pandemia Covid-19 e as consequentes restrições tiveram na evolução e mudança do perfil, tais como o aumento da importância da flexibilidade nas condições de contratação dos serviços, preocupação relativamente às medidas sanitárias e a procura de espaços exteriores. This dissertation aims to understand the current profile of the buyers of corporate events and meetings in the Cascais Municipality, from the organizers' perspective, to ascertain the pattern of customer demand and attitude towards three current trends. The study began with the research of the characteristics of corporate clients during the buying and planning process, as well as their job roles and responsibilities. Was also developed a study of their profile regarding their attitude towards three current global trends: sustainability, hybrid and online events, and diversity and inclusion. Finally, was analyzed the evolution and change of the profile in the temporal context pre and post 2020 (Covid-19 pandemic). In addition to the research carried out through the literature review, interviews were conducted with corporate event organizers from several hotel units and event venues in the Municipality of Cascais, as well as organizers working in event companies responsible for corporate events that take place in various locations in the Municipality of Cascais. After analyzing the results of the interviews, it is possible to verify that the profile of corporate clients in the Municipality of Cascais is currently defined by a set of diversified characteristics, with a growing awareness towards sustainability, diversity and inclusion practices, although still with a very small dimension, and with a current interest for hybrid events, as a complement to face-to-face events. It is also possible to highlight the impact that the Covid-19 pandemic and the consequent restrictions had in the evolution and change of the profile, such as the increased importance of flexibility in the conditions of contracting services, concern about sanitary measures and the demand for outdoor spaces.

    Mestrado Bolonha em Economia Internacional e Estudos Europeus A Economia Circular enquanto modelo disruptivo face ao paradigma da linearidade em economia, apresenta um impacto positivo quanto à utilização e manutenção dos recursos por mais tempo no processo produtivo. Este é um aspeto essencial uma vez que os recursos são cada vez mais limitados devido à degradação das condições ambientais e alterações climáticas que assolam todo o Mundo e têm efeitos preocupantes na economia. Assim, a implementação dos princípios associados à circularidade tem vindo a ser cada vez mais uma prioridade ao nível da União Europeia e, também, ao nível dos diferentes países. Através da substituição do conceito de “fim-de-vida” dos produtos, por um sistema industrial restaurador, que promova a restauração dos resíduos, mudanças quanto ao uso de energias renováveis e de materiais tóxicos terá um impacto importante nos modelos de negócios. Neste sentido, os incentivos financeiros a esta área têm vindo a aumentar e a COVID-19 só feio aprofundar a importância da adoção destes princípios para uma recuperação económica mais resiliente. Esta sem sido uma preocupação transversal a todos os setores, como é o caso do setor dos produtos resinosos e seus derivados, em Portugal, dada a relevância do mesmo para a sustentabilidade da fileira florestal e do respetivo ecossistema. A Economia Circular enquanto estratégia para uma Europa mais verde evidencia sem dúvida, uma oportunidade de desenvolvimento dos sistemas produtivos em termos de eficiência e impacto no ambiente. Esta dissertação pretende explorar esta estratégia e analisar a forma como a União Europeia tem vindo promover a implementação da mesma, através dos seus apoios dedicados, estudando o caso da circularidade económica no setor dos produtos resinosos e seus derivados, em Portugal. The Circular Economy as a disruptive model against the linearity paradigm in economics, has a positive impact on the use and maintenance of resources for longer in the production process. This is an essential aspect since resources are increasingly limited due to the degradation of environmental conditions and climate change that plague the world and have worrying effects on the economy. Thus, the implementation of the principles associated with circularity has become an increasing priority at the European Union level and at the level country level. By replacing the concept of "end-of-life" products, by a restorative industrial system that promotes the restoration of waste, changes in the use of renewable energy and toxic materials will have an important impact on business models. In this sense, financial incentives to this area have been increasing and COVID19 has only deepened the importance of adopting these principles for a more resilient economic recovery. This has been a concern across all sectors, as is the case of the sector of the resin products and its derivatives in Portugal, given its relevance to the sustainability of the forestry industry and its ecosystem. The Circular Economy as a strategy for a greener Europe undoubtedly shows an opportunity to develop production systems in terms of efficiency and impact on the environment. This dissertation aims to explore this strategy and analyze how the European Union has been promoting its implementation through its dedicated support, studying the case of economic circularity in the sector of resin products and its derivatives in Portugal. info:eu-repo/semantics/publishedVersion

    Given the existing environmental problems, working with Environmental Education in Early Childhood Education is essential to awaken in children the interest about nature and promote the transformation of values. The Environmental Education proposal delimited here was applied in the municipal pre-school system of Uberlândia - MG, as an alternative to, initially, bring awareness to a group of 18 chidren, aged from 2 to 4 years old, as well as their families regarding the preservation of the natural resources, especially in relation to the themes of Water and Ecological Footprint. This research was carried out through a qualitative approach, using action research as a method, in which the child and the family actively participate as researched and researchers in the entire project. The chidren and their families participated in both the remote teaching modality, due to the pandemic caused by Covid-19, as well as the face- to-face teaching modality. From previous diagnosis of chidren’s Knowledge about the topics covered in the research applied in the investigated group, several pedagogical strategies were adopted: chidren’s educational videos on the themes, storytelling through theater and book reading, music, dance, games and surveys applied in the form of images, all based on action research and with a content-rationalist educational approach. The proposals applied aimed at raising consciousness among chidren and their family members regarding pollution, contamination, water importance and its waste, focusing on its usage in daily activities and diseases related to it. The analysis of the results revealed that motivating pedagogical strategies are potential for raising awareness among students, but that they must become continuous to reinforce the environmental problem of the water crisis that devastates the world, as well as to establish in these individuals and their families the notion of conscious consumption. ; Pesquisa sem auxílio de agências de fomento ; Dissertação (Mestrado) ; Diante dos problemas ...

    As mudanças climáticas têm levado algumas indústrias a investir em novas pesquisas e tecnologias para a produção de energia a partir de fontes renováveis, como, por exemplo, a energia eólica, solar e hidroelétrica. Muito devido à sua localização geográfica, a região do Nordeste do Brasil tem grandes investidores no setor da energia eólica (energia produzida a partir da força e da frequência do vento), contudo, durante a construção dos parques eólicos, não existe uma obrigatoriedade, segundo a legislação brasileira, de utilizar investimento em projetos de responsabilidade social com a comunidade local. A instalação dessas empresas traz oportunidades de emprego e rendimento para as famílias, porém, após a conclusão das obras e do início da operacionalização, as ações em benefícios a comunidade já não são realizadas com frequência. O principal objetivo do presente trabalho é conhecer os impactos dos projetos que foram desenvolvidos pelas empresas de energias renováveis em três escolas públicas na cidade de Trairi-CE. Como critério metodológico, foram aplicados 2 inquéritos com questões objetivas e subjetivas em março de 2021, destinados à comunidade (gestores, professores, funcionários e pais de alunos) e aos colaboradores (Chief Finance Officer, gestores e coordenadores) das empresas de energias renováveis instaladas no município de Trairi. A plataforma eletrónica “Google Forms” foi utilizada como ferramenta de aplicação desses questionários, permitindo alcançar os diferentes públicos, contudo, as regras de distanciamento social e sanitárias, resultante da pandemia COVID-19, e o facto de algumas pessoas, principalmente o público “comunidade” não terem facilidade de acesso à internet e também em acompanhar certas medias digitais, o número baixo de respostas deste público resultou em apenas 87 pessoas. Relativamente às razões que levam as empresas a investir em práticas de responsabilidade social, 72,7% dos inquiridos afirmam tratar-se de exigências das Instituições Financeiras. O mesmo percentual de respondentes apontou ter como principal dificuldade em implementar ações sociais a falta de estrutura institucional ou administrativa dos beneficiários, seguida pela falta de plano de continuidade e manutenção por partes dos mesmos (45,5% dos inquiridos). Cerca de 45,5% dos participantes afirmaram que o Projeto Educação (Construção de estrutura física, doação de equipamentos de informática e/ou formação sobre didática educacional e pedagógica) e o Projeto Saúde na escola (odontológica) foram os que geraram mais impacto na comunidade. Para o público da comunidade, cerca de 96,3% revelam que as ações das empresas beneficiaram a população e que o nível de melhoria indicado por 51,9% dos participantes foi alto. Já para 42% dos participantes, a perceção de melhoria foi de relevância média e apenas 6,1% consideram baixa ou quase insignificante. Globalmente, as empresas realizam projetos na área da responsabilidade principalmente por das “instituições” financeiras, e somente acontece durante a construção do empreendimento. Há fatores que mostram que os investimentos em práticas de responsabilidade social não se dão pela da cultura da empresa e/ou de forma voluntária, também não possuem políticas de acompanhamento dos resultados, levando assim à rotura da relação com a comunidade e da total conclusão dos projetos implementados. Climate change has led some industries to invest in new research and technologies for the production of energy from renewable sources, such as wind, solar and hydroelectric energy. Much due to its geographic location, the Northeast region of Brazil has large investors in the wind energy sector (energy produced from the strength and frequency of the wind), however, during the construction of wind farms, there is no obligation, according to Brazilian legislation, to use investment in social responsibility projects with the local community. The installation of these companies brings job and income opportunities for the families, however, after the completion of the works and the beginning of the operation, actions to benefit the community are no longer carried out frequently. The main objective of this work is to know the impacts of projects that were developed by renewable energy companies in three public schools in the city of Trairi-CE. As a methodological criterion, 2 surveys with objective and subjective questions were applied in March 2021, aimed at the community (managers, teachers, employees and parents of students) and employees (Chief Finance Officer, managers and coordinators) of the installed renewable energy companies in the municipality of Trairi. The electronic platform “Google Forms” was used as a tool to apply these questionnaires, allowing to reach different audiences, however, the rules of social and health distance, resulting from the COVID-19 pandemic, and the fact that some people, mainly the public “community” do not have easy access to the internet and also to follow certain digital media, the low number of responses from this audience resulted in only 87 people. Regarding the reasons that lead companies to invest in social responsibility practices, 72.7% of respondents say that these are requirements of Financial Institutions. The same percentage of respondents indicated that the main difficulty in implementing social actions was the lack of institutional or administrative structure of the beneficiaries, followed by the lack of a continuity and maintenance plan by their parts (45.5% of respondents). About 45.5% of the participants stated that the Education Project (Construction of a physical structure, donation of computer equipment and/or training in educational and pedagogical teaching) and the Health Project at School (dental) were the ones that generated the most impact on community. For the community audience, around 96.3% reveal that the companies' actions benefited the population and that the level of improvement indicated by 51.9% of the participants was high. For 42% of the participants, the perception of improvement was of medium relevance and only 6.1% considered it low or almost insignificant. Globally, companies carry out projects in the area of responsibility mainly for the financial “instructions”, and this only happens during the construction of the project. There are factors that show that investments in social responsibility practices are not based on the company's culture and/or on a voluntary basis, they also do not have results monitoring policies, thus leading to the rupture of the relationship with the community and the total conclusion of the projects implemented.

    A presente tese de mestrado visa a compreensão do impacto do turismo massificado e da sustentabilidade no setor da reabilitação de edifícios na freguesia de Cedofeita, localizada na cidade do Porto, entre o período de 2015 e 2020. Em uma primeira fase, destacou-se a importância da compreensão dos conceitos internacionais de conservação, reabilitação e restauro de forma a obter um bom alicerce para compreender como tem sido feita a reabilitação de edifícios históricos e de edifícios comuns. Diante do cenário apresentado, o objetivo geral desta investigação é apresentar uma leitura integrada dos tópicos que envolvem a reabilitação, o turismo de massas e a sustentabilidade. A partir desse cenário, abordou-se a reabilitação urbana predominante em uma das maiores cidades portuguesas, o Porto. Em uma primeira fase, analisou-se o impacto negativo e positivo do turismo massificado no Porto entre 2015 e 2020, ocasionando os fenômenos da turistificação e aceleração da gentrificação. Salientou-se a relação do turismo com a reabilitação e de como os reflexos desta união afetam a economia. O setor imobiliário a longo, médio e curto prazo assumiu grande importância no contexto turístico. Devido a esse fator, empresas como o Airbnb, que pertence ao ramo do alojamento, e a Idealista, que pertence ao setor imobiliário, ganharam maior evidência no setor imobiliário habitacional portuense. Em um segundo momento, a pesquisa teve como foco a análise do impacto da situação pandémica provocada pelo COVID-19, tendo como base especificamente os edifícios históricos e comuns reabilitados na região de Cedofeita. Empresas como a Remax e a Era já existiam independentemente do turismo, mas também contribuíram com o crescimento do setor imobiliário. Relata-se também o impacto da pandemia COVID-19 no ano de 2020 e 2021 que afetou o turismo de forma extraordinária e sem precedentes. Posteriormente, propõe-se uma reflexão sobre a implementação da sustentabilidade na reabilitação edilícia no contexto específico do Porto. Os países pertencentes à União Europeia, em 2019, assinaram o Pacto Ecológico Europeu que visa atingir a neutralidade carbônica até 2050. Face ao acordo, estão sendo elaboradas medidas específicas em cada país de forma a atingir o objetivo. Nesta etapa foi apontado o conceito de Economia Circular e os seus efeitos na economia portuguesa, bem como as vantagens da implementação da tecnologia BIM aplicada à sustentabilidade edilícia. O BIM é uma tecnologia que contribuído com o alcance da sustentabilidade na reabilitação de edifícios do Porto. A fim de que seja proposta uma análise dos edifícios reabilitados no Porto, foi feito um recorte geográfico e temporal, tendo-se selecionado os edifícios pertencentes à freguesia de Cedofeita, reabilitados de 2015 a 2020 como caso de estudo. This master's thesis aims to understand the impact of mass tourism and sustainability in the sector of rehabilitation of buildings in the parish of Cedofeita, located in the city of Porto, between 2015 and 2020. In a first stage we tried to highlight the understanding of international concepts of conservation, rehabilitation and restoration in order to obtain a good basis to identify how the rehabilitation of historic buildings and common buildings has been carried out. Given the scenario presented, the general objective of this investigation is to outline an integrated reading of the topics that involve rehabilitation, mass tourism and sustainability. Accordingly, an approach to the predominant urban rehabilitation in one of the largest Portuguese citie as Porto, was made In a first phase the negative and positive impact of mass tourism causing the phenomena of touristification and acceleration of gentrification, in Porto, between 2015 and 2020 was analyzed, The relationship between tourism and rehabilitation was highlighted as the effects of the gathering of these two issues affect the economy. The long, medium and short term real estate sector has assumed great importance in the tourism context. Due to this factor, companies such as Airbnb, which belongs to the accommodation sector, and Idealista, which belongs to the real estate sector, gained greater evidence in the Porto housing real estate sector. In a second moment, the research focused on analyzing the impact of the pandemic situation caused by COVID-19, specifically based on the historic and common buildings rehabilitated in the Cedofeita region. Companies like Remax and Era already existed independently of mass tourism, but they also contributed to the growth of the real estate sector. The impact of the COVID-19 pandemic in the year 2020 and 2021 is also reported, as a factor that affected tourism in an extraordinary and unprecedented way. Subsequently, a reflection on the implementation of sustainability in building rehabilitation in the specific context of Porto is proposed. The countries belonging to the European Union, in 2019, signed the European Ecological Pact, which aims to achieve carbon neutrality by 2050. In view of the agreement, specific measures are being prepared in each country in order to achieve the goal. At this stage, the concept of the Circular Economy and its effects on the Portuguese economy were pointed out, as well as the advantages of implementing BIM technology applied to building sustainability. BIM is a technology that has contributed to achieving sustainability in the rehabilitation of buildings in Porto. In order to propose an analysis of the rehabilitated buildings in Porto, a geographical and temporal framework was made, having selected the buildings belonging to the parish of Cedofeita, rehabilitated from 2015 to 2020 as a case study.
